Types of pallet stretch wrapper automatic

Automatic pallet stretch wrappers are an efficient way to wrap large and heavy loads and ensure that they are securely and tightly wrapped. Automatic pallet stretch wrappers are used to wrap products on pallets or without pallets for safe shipment or storage. They are available in various models to meet different needs and applications.

  • Automatic turntable stretch wrapper: It is a stretch wrapper that uses a turntable to rotate the pallet or product while wrapping it with stretch film. The wrapped pallet is then ejected from the wrapping station, either manually or automatically. An automatic turntable stretch wrapper is easy to use and has high wrapping efficiency.
  • Automatic traverse arm stretch wrapper: An automatic horizontal arm stretch wrapper has an arm that extends horizontally across a stationary pallet to wrap it. The horizontal arm moves up and down to adjust to different pallet heights, making it suitable for wrapping products of various sizes. It has a higher wrapping speed than the turntable stretch wrapper, providing greater efficiency in the packaging process.
  • Automatic stretch wrapper with pallet pusher: This machine model is equipped with a pallet pusher that pushes the wrapped pallet to a film cutting and attaching unit. It is helpful for operations that have to wrap a high volume of boxes or products per day with either stretchable or non-stretchable materials.
  • Rotating disc stretch wrapper: Unlike traditional methods, where items are wrapped by moving them around, this innovation involves moving a circular platform or disc while keeping the item stationary. Rotating discs can reduce wrapping expenses and film waste, particularly for products without bottoms that need wrapping from the base up.

Specifications and maintenance of pallet stretch wrapper automatic

The automatic pallet wrapper machine has many parameters that determine how it wraps products. Some of the essential parameters include the width and height of the wrapping film; the size of the pallet it can hold; the speed at which it rotates, which is sometimes called wrapping speed; and the tension control for the wrapping film.

  • Width and height of wrapping film: The stretch wrapper machines come in several sizes, accommodating various widths up to 18 inches (0.46 meters). The required height depends on how tall the pallets are—film heights range up to 80 inches (2.03 meters) or more.
  • Pallet size: The pallet dimensions depend on the length (up to 49 inches or 1.2 meters) and width (up to 41 inches or 1.04 meters). Most pallets that need wrapping are between these lengths.
  • Wrapping speed: Turntable speed for a rotary pallet stretch wrapper is its linear speed, which ranges from 40 to 120 inches per minute (1 to 3 meters per minute). Higher turntable speeds result in saving more time and higher productivity.
  • Tension control: Wrapping tension is a vital parameter in determining how much force is applied to the wrapping film when the pallet is wrapped. The tension can be customized in the stretch wrapper machines, and different constructions require different wrapping tensions. The tension is expressed in pounds and can range from 5 to 30 pounds (2.3 to 13.6 kg) or more.

TLC (tension, length, and control) is a commonly used term in stretch wrapping. Under TLC, tension is the force on the film while wrapping is done. The length refers to how much film is necessary to wrap the unit. Control is how the film's length and tension are controlled while wrapping is done, like in a programmable stretch wrapper.

To keep an automatic stretch pallet wrapper in good working condition, some maintenance tips can go a long way in keeping the machine in tip-top shape. Regular cleaning is an essential maintenance tip. It helps remove any film residue or debris that can affect performance.

Another helpful maintenance tip is lubricating moving parts like bearings, rollers, and chains. Careful inspection of electrical components and cable connections can also prevent stretching wrappers from malfunctioning.

Since some machines are automatic, it is necessary to check the hydraulic fluids from time to time. These fluid levels should be optimal for machinery to function correctly. Gear and motor should be examined occasionally so that any abnormal noises or signs of wear can be detected early, preventing further damage and eliminating the need for costly repairs.

How to choose pallet stretch wrappers automatic

When purchasing pallet stretch wrapper automatics, buyers should consider several factors such as packaging film types, packaging speed, load stability, adaptability, control system, safety features, and maintenance requirements.

People should first determine the types of packaging films compatible with the stretch wrapper they want to purchase. They should consider the machine's compatibility with different packaging film types, like stretch film, shrink film, or stretch hood film. Also, they should consider the film's width and diameter that the wrapper can accommodate.

Another crucial factor to consider is packaging speed. Various stretch wrappers have distinct packaging speeds. For instance, turntable stretch wrappers are faster than rotary arm stretch wrappers. The turntable stretch wrapper rotates the pallet and the packing film around it, while the rotary arm revolves around the pallet. When purchasing, choose a stretch wrapper with adequate speed based on the packaging volume demands.

One may opt for a stretch pallet wrapper with load stability if they regularly deal with unstable loads, for instance, pallets or packages with odd shapes. Go for stretch wrappers with extra securing features, like strapping or dunnage, if load stability is a concern.

A stretch wrapper that can accommodate different pallet shapes, heights, and sizes is ideal if adaptability is needed. Consider a stretch wrapper that can adjust wrapping parameters like film tension, speed, and height if adaptability is essential.

The stretch wrapper’s control system can also influence the decision. Many stretch wrappers have automatic and semi-automatic modes. When in the semi-automatic mode, the operator triggers the machine, while, in the automatic mode, the machine performs a wrapping task automatically without any operator assistance. Choose a stretch wrapper with an easy-to-read control system depending on the required skill level and other factors.

When purchasing stretch film wrappers, consider the safety features like emergency stop buttons and interlocks. These features promote operator safety, especially in fast-paced environments.

Lastly, the maintenance requirements demand consideration. Because of their mechanical complexity, stretch wrappers need maintenance. Buyers should choose machines that are easy to access and service that have clear maintenance instructions.

Q&A

Q1: How durable is the stretch film used with pallet stretch wrappers?

A1: Stretch film is made with either polyethylene or blown polyethylene. It is made to withstand shipping and storage. With the right amount of tension applied while wrapping, the film can hold items tightly for weeks or even months.

Q2: How complicated are pallet stretch wrappers to operate?

A2: Automatic stretch wrap machines are very user-friendly. Pallets are positioned on the turntable, and the wrapping cycle is started. After wrapping, the wrapped pallet can be released without manual engagement. This makes automatic wrappers suitable for high-volume packaging.

Q3: Are pallet stretch wrappers worth the cost?

A3: Stretch wrappers increase packaging speed and reduce film usage. They improve the stability of loads during transportation and reduce the need for manual packaging. In terms of cost, stretch wrappers are economical. Manual wrapping takes more time and uses more packaging material.

Q4: Can stretch wrappers handle pallets of different sizes?

A4: Stretch wrappers are adjusted to wrap pallets of different heights and diameters. The dimensions of the pallet should be matched with those of the stretch wrapper before purchase.
